Due to a landslide that occurred during the transition in Manisa, three lanes of the Istanbul-İzmir Highway have become unusable. Transportation is being provided in a controlled manner from one direction. Work is ongoing at the scene.
Due to a landslide that occurred during the Manisa transition of the Istanbul-İzmir Highway, disruptions in transportation were experienced. Transportation is being provided in a controlled manner from one direction due to the landslide. The landslide occurred in the section of the Istanbul-İzmir Highway between the Saruhanlı and Turgutlu districts. After the heavy rains in the region, soil and rock fragments broke off from the slope and scattered onto the road. Upon notification, a large number of highway gendarmerie, security, and highway teams were dispatched to the scene.
3 LANES BECAME COMPLETELY UNUSABLE
As a result of the landslide, 3 lanes of the highway became completely unusable, while gendarmerie teams closed the area affected by the landslide to traffic for safety reasons, and transportation is being provided in a controlled manner from one lane. It has been learned that work in the region is ongoing to completely clear the road and ensure full safety.
An investigation into the incident is ongoing.
